TLHF5800 Equivalent & Substitute Parts

Part Overview

The TLHF5800 is an orange 605nm LED indicator manufactured by Vishay Semiconductor Opto Division, configured as a discrete 2V radial through-hole component in T-1 3/4 (5mm) package. This part is classified as obsolete, making equivalent and substitute parts necessary for ongoing design support and procurement.

The TLHF5800 delivers 3500mcd at 20mA test current with an 8° viewing angle and 13.10mm maximum height. Its clear lens and round domed top design support standard LED indication applications requiring narrow beam concentration.

Substitute Part Grouping Explanation

Substitution for the TLHF5800 is determined by the following critical parameters:

Primary Matching Criteria:

  • Color: Orange
  • Wavelength - Dominant: 605nm (±5nm tolerance acceptable for orange LEDs)
  • Voltage - Forward (Vf): 2V nominal (1.98V–2.02V acceptable)
  • Current - Test: 20mA
  • Mounting Type: Through Hole
  • Package / Case: Radial
  • Lens Size: 5mm, T-1 3/4
  • Lens Style: Round with Domed Top
  • Lens Transparency: Clear

Secondary Considerations:

  • Millicandela Rating: Substitutes may vary; higher ratings provide increased brightness margin
  • Viewing Angle: Substitutes may differ; narrower angles (8°) maintain original beam characteristics
  • Height: Substitutes with lower maximum height (8.85mm–8.91mm) offer improved PCB clearance
  • Product Status: Active status ensures ongoing availability and supply chain stability

The substitute parts listed below maintain compatibility across all primary matching criteria while offering active product status and improved availability compared to the obsolete TLHF5800.

Engineering Selection Recommendations

Primary Substitutes (Wavelength-Matched, 605nm):

HLMP-EJ08-WZ000 and HLMP-EJ08-X1000 from Broadcom Limited are the closest functional equivalents to the TLHF5800. Both maintain the 605nm dominant wavelength, 8° viewing angle, 5mm T-1 3/4 lens size, and through-hole radial package. Forward voltage is 1.98V, within acceptable tolerance of the 2V specification. Both parts are active products with ROHS3 compliance and unlimited moisture sensitivity rating. The HLMP-EJ08-WZ000 delivers 10750mcd and HLMP-EJ08-X1000 delivers 14100mcd, providing increased brightness compared to the original 3500mcd rating. Height is 8.91mm, reducing PCB clearance requirements versus the original 13.10mm.

Secondary Substitutes (Orange Color, Radial Package, Through-Hole Mount):

The Everlight 7343-2USOC series parts (7343-2USOC/H2/S400-A7, 7343-2USOC/H2/S400-A8, 7343-2USOC/H2/S530-A5, 7343-2USOC/S400-A7, 7343-2USOC/S530-A3, 7343-2USOC/S530-A5) maintain orange color, 2V forward voltage, 20mA test current, through-hole radial mounting, and ROHS3 compliance. These parts operate at 615nm dominant wavelength, which differs from the original 605nm specification. Viewing angles range from 20° to 30°, broader than the original 8°. Millicandela ratings range from 1000mcd to 2000mcd. Height is 8.85mm. These parts are suitable for applications where wavelength tolerance and viewing angle variation are acceptable.

Not Recommended:

383-2UYC/S530-A3 from Everlight is a yellow LED (589nm dominant wavelength) and does not match the orange color specification of the TLHF5800. 7343-2USOC/H2/S400-A2 is a red LED (615nm) and does not match the orange color specification.

Frequently Asked Questions (FAQ)

Q: Can I use HLMP-EJ08-WZ000 or HLMP-EJ08-X1000 as direct replacements for TLHF5800?

A: Yes. Both Broadcom parts match the critical parameters: 605nm dominant wavelength, orange color, 2V forward voltage, 20mA test current, 8° viewing angle, 5mm T-1 3/4 lens, through-hole radial package, and ROHS3 compliance. Forward voltage is 1.98V, within acceptable tolerance. Both are active products with unlimited moisture sensitivity. The primary difference is increased brightness (10750mcd and 14100mcd respectively versus 3500mcd) and reduced height (8.91mm versus 13.10mm).

Q: What is the difference between the Everlight 7343-2USOC series and the TLHF5800?

A: The Everlight 7343-2USOC series maintains orange color, 2V forward voltage, 20mA test current, through-hole radial mounting, and ROHS3 compliance. However, they operate at 615nm dominant wavelength instead of 605nm, and feature broader viewing angles (20°–30° versus 8°). Millicandela ratings are lower (1000–2000mcd versus 3500mcd). These parts are suitable for applications where wavelength tolerance and viewing angle variation are acceptable.

Q: Why is the TLHF5800 obsolete?

A: The TLHF5800 is classified as obsolete by Vishay Semiconductor Opto Division. Active substitute parts from Broadcom and Everlight provide equivalent or superior performance with ongoing supply chain support.

Q: Does package height matter when substituting the TLHF5800?

A: Yes. The original TLHF5800 has a maximum height of 13.10mm. All substitute parts listed have maximum heights of 8.85mm–8.91mm, reducing PCB clearance requirements. Verify that reduced height does not conflict with mechanical constraints in your application.

Q: Are all substitute parts ROHS3 compliant?

A: Yes. All substitute parts listed carry ROHS3 compliance and unlimited moisture sensitivity rating (MSL 1), matching the environmental specifications of the TLHF5800.

Q: Can I substitute a 615nm orange LED for the 605nm TLHF5800?

A: The Everlight 7343-2USOC series operates at 615nm. Substitution is acceptable if your application tolerates a 10nm wavelength shift and broader viewing angle (20°–30° versus 8°). Verify that color perception and beam characteristics remain acceptable for your specific indication application.
